Turning Unclear Growth Plans into A Structured Revenue Roadmap Plan for The Nation’s Largest Women’s & Children’s Healthcare Clinic Chain

From unclear growth assumptions to a 75%-mapped revenue plan grounded in financial, operational, and organizational reality.

CHALLANGE

“What looked like strong growth potential for one of the leading Women’s & Children’s Healthcare Clinic Chains revealed a deeper gap—no clarity on value, cost, or returns.”

The business had clear growth potential, but no clear view of where that growth would actually come from, what it would cost, or what gaps stood in the way. Without a structured understanding of performance across the organization, growth planning remained assumption driven. For leadership, the real risk wasn’t lack of opportunity, it was committing capital without a defensible path to returns.

APPROACH

“We brought structure to growth identifying true performance drivers, aligning priorities, and translating insights into a clear, investable roadmap.”

01

Diagnose the Business Across Core Growth Drivers

We conducted a structured maturity assessment across financial performance, organizational effectiveness, lifecycle economics, and overall business readiness to identify what was actually driving growth and what was holding it back.

02

Surface What Matters and Reallocate Focus

We translated fragmented data into a clear picture of performance, highlighting priority gaps, optimizing resource allocation, and aligning leadership around what would move the business forward.

03

Build a Defensible Growth Roadmap

We converted the assessment into a practical roadmap, mapping 75% of the revenue growth plan with clear assumptions, priorities, and execution paths aligned to the next investment cycle.
